titleOfInvention |
Coproduction of 6-aminocapronitrile and hexamethylenediamine |
abstract |
A process for the coproduction of 6-aminocapronitrile (CAN) and hexamethylenediamine (HMD) by treatment of adiponitrile (AND) with hydrogen in the presence of a nickel-containing catalyst at temperatures not below room temperature and elevated hydrogen partial pressure in the presence or absence of a solvent, which comprises, after the conversion based on AND and/or the selectivity based on CAN has or have dropped below a defined value (a) interrupting the treatment of AND with hydrogen by stopping the feed of AND and of the solvent, if used, (b) treating the catalyst at from 150 to 400 DEG C with hydrogen using a hydrogen pressure within the range from 0.1 to 30 MPa and a treatment time within the range from 2 to 48 h, and c then continuing the hydrogenation of AND with the treated catalyst of stage (b). |
